The Challenge of Hunger in Vulnerable Communities

Hunger remains a prevalent issue affecting millions of people worldwide, leaving them without adequate nutrition and negatively impacting their overall health and well-being. Vulnerable communities, including low-income families, children, seniors, and homeless individuals, often bear the brunt of this challenge. According to recent statistics:

  • An estimated 690 million people go to bed hungry each night, with the majority residing in developing countries (Food and Agriculture Organization).
  • In the United States alone, more than 37 million people struggle with food insecurity, including 11 million children (Feeding America).
  • Globally, malnutrition is responsible for nearly half of all deaths in children under the age of five (World Health Organization).

The Sushi for Change Initiative

The Sushi for Change initiative was launched by a renowned sushi chef and his team to tackle food insecurity in their community. They organized a series of sushi nights at local restaurants, offering a unique sushi menu and exciting flavors to attract attendees.

During these events, a percentage of the profits was donated to local food banks and organizations specializing in providing meals to those in need. Additionally, each guest had the opportunity to make an extra voluntary contribution towards the cause.

The initiative garnered significant attention, resulting in community members coming together to enjoy delicious sushi while contributing towards a meaningful cause. The success of the Sushi for Change initiative inspired other sushi chefs and communities to replicate this model, amplifying its impact across different regions.
